Oats can be eaten uncooked as in muesli, cooked with water, milk, or orange juice as in porridge, cookies, and oatmeal desserts. Or here, it is used in pan cakes/waffles. 

Bite of history: oatmeal began over 32 000 years ago when Paleolithic peoples ground wild oats into a porridge for food in southern Italy. It reached the Western Bank's of the Joran Valley ca 11 000 years ago. Ancient Romans brought oats to Britain. It is now a stable in Scotland. The first commercial brand appeared in the United States in 1877.

~pan cakes~
1 cup (130 g) organic (gluten-free) oatmeal
2 organic apples, grated
2 organic eggs
2/3 cups (150 g) (dairy-free) yogurt or orange juice
1 tsp. (5 g) baking powder
1/2 tsp. (2.5 g) cinnamon
1 Tbs (10o g) chia and flax seeds

~waffles~
1 cup (130 g) organic (GF) oatmeal
2 organic apples, grated
1 organic egg
2 cups (260 g) organic orange juice
2 Tbs. olive oil
1 Tbs. (10 g) each: chia and flax seeds

ūnus I. Mix all ingredients.
duo II. Makes pan cakes or 2 waffles
trēs III. Serve with favorite toppings.
